2003 Citroen C2 vs. 1949 Triumph Renown
To start off, 2003 Citroen C2 is newer by 54 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1949 Triumph Renown.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1949 Triumph Renown would be higher. At 2,088 cc (4 cylinders), 1949 Triumph Renown is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1949 Triumph Renown (67 HP @ 4200 RPM) has 9 more horse power than 2003 Citroen C2. (58 HP @ 5500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1949 Triumph Renown should accelerate faster than 2003 Citroen C2.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1949 Triumph Renown weights approximately 344 kg more than 2003 Citroen C2.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 1949 Triumph Renown (148 Nm @ 2000 RPM) has 38 more torque (in Nm) than 2003 Citroen C2. (110 Nm @ 3200 RPM). This means 1949 Triumph Renown will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2003 Citroen C2.
Compare all specifications:
2003 Citroen C2 | 1949 Triumph Renown | |
Make | Citroen | Triumph |
Model | C2 | Renown |
Year Released | 2003 | 1949 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1124 cc | 2088 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 58 HP | 67 HP |
Engine RPM | 5500 RPM | 4200 RPM |
Torque | 110 Nm | 148 Nm |
Torque RPM | 3200 RPM | 2000 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 72 mm | 85 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 69 mm | 92 mm |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Vehicle Weight | 936 kg | 1280 kg |
Vehicle Length | 3670 mm | 4450 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1670 mm | 1630 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1470 mm | 1610 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2320 mm | 2750 mm |
